Breakdown: Finding strength in the edge of collapse.
ONEWAY is a Christian rock band started by Dustin Burkhard, a musician from Dayton. For 16 years, Dustin was a youth pastor and worship leader at the same time, and these two things made a big impact on his way of making music. That is why his songs not only have a good message but also have a great musical structure. Additionally, the amount of energy he delivers is on par with Skillet.

Classic roots, modern fire: Dave Lebental’s "Stylus".
Dave Lebental started in the 90s with Sunflower and Placebo Royale. Fans followed him through California's live scene. He's played with big names and built a quiet fanbase. Now he leads Karma Train, a strong live band. They play songs full of feeling and strong melodies. So the music still sounds like classic rock. He writes, records, and puts it out himself. "Bullseye": Drew Six fires a shot with determined heartland rock.
Drew Six plays country and rock from Kansas City. Bruce Springsteen, Kip Moore, Eric Church, and John Mellencamp inspire him. He brings heartland tunes to life on stage. The music feels real and raw. Plus, it sounds honest. Seems like people connect with it. Drew Six is an experienced live performer and has performed worldwide. His music is a mixture of Americana taste and contemporary country production. He writes songs that touch the hearts of the audience.
